In the UK, DNA testing while pregnant can be conducted through a non-invasive prenatal paternity test (NIPT) This test detects the genetic material of the fetus in the mother’s bloodstream and can be performed as early as 8-10 weeks into the pregnancy The cost of this type of test can vary depending on the provider and the specific circumstances of the case.

On average, the cost of a DNA test while pregnant in the UK can range from £400 to £800 This price typically includes the testing kit, laboratory analysis, and a detailed report of the results Some providers may also offer additional services, such as express testing or legal documentation, which can increase the overall cost.

It is important to note that DNA testing while pregnant is not typically covered by the NHS, as it is considered an elective procedure This means that the cost of the test will need to be paid out of pocket by the individual or family seeking the testing dna test while pregnant uk cost.
